Handover Note — From Dalia Wren to Omar Teskitt

Sales leads, for awareness: the Northfield division hiring freeze at Quellan Group continues through the end of the fiscal year. Open reqs are paused, not cancelled. Pipeline coverage stays with existing account teams; escalate capacity gaps to Omar directly. Comp plans are unaffected. Customer-facing messaging: say nothing proactively. The reasoning behind the freeze is summarized in the restricted note below.

internal memo for kawip-hadug: Headcount on the Wenwyn team goes from 7 to 140 by the end of January. Gross margin on Wenwyn came in at 20 percent against a plan of 15 percent.

## Service Accounts — Tidemark Widget

The Tidemark tide-table widget uses one service account against the internal Moonpull forecast API. Scope: read-only, coastal endpoints only. Rotation is quarterly; next rotation noted in the sync agenda. Do not reuse this account for the buoy dashboard — it has its own. For local testing, use the key below.

gateway credential: kto3_qfe

## Offline Mode — FieldTrace Survey

When connectivity drops, FieldTrace queues survey submissions in the local SQLite spool and retries on a backoff timer. Reviewers: confirm the spool cap is enforced before merge — unbounded growth bricked two tablets during the Harkness Valley pilot. Sync resumes automatically once the beacon endpoint responds twice within the health window. Do not change flush ordering; dedupe depends on it. Verify the client build reads these values at startup, not per-sync. The current offline configuration is as follows.

settings of hadup-kajop:
HOLATH_PIN=1733
HOLATH_METRICS_HOST=metrics.holath.qirvanworks.corp
HOLATH_LOG_LEVEL=error
HOLATH_TENANT=belael

Minutes — Management Meeting, Harrowgate Mills site. Attendees: M. Fenwick, L. Oduya, T. Brask. The committee reviewed the landlord's revised terms for the Calder Quay premises, noting the proposed 9% uplift and shortened break clause. Counsel will draft counter-terms by Friday. Heads of department should treat the following position as strictly confidential.

management briefing: Jorixax Holdings is in early talks to buy Casixax Holdings for about $420.3 million. The Fenmir launch date is October 27, and nothing goes to the press before then. Legal wants the Keloxek Foods term sheet redrafted before April 16.